What is an informed waiver consent template?
An Informed Waiver Consent Template is a legal document that outlines the rights and responsibilities of parties entering an agreement or participating in an activity. Typically used in contexts such as healthcare, research, and events, it ensures that individuals understand the risks and implications before consenting.
Why you might need to create an informed waiver consent template
Organizations and individuals need informed waiver consent templates to protect themselves legally. By ensuring that all parties understand and agree to the conditions of participation, potential disputes can be minimized. Furthermore, it provides a formal record of consent, which is critical for compliance with regulations in various industries.

Typical use-cases and sectors that often utilize informed waiver consent templates
Various sectors require informed waiver consent templates to function effectively:
-
1.Healthcare: Used to obtain patient consent for procedures and treatments.
-
2.Research Institutions: Employed when conducting studies involving human subjects.
-
3.Event Organizers: Essential for participants in physical activities or events.
-
4.Legal Professionals: Utilized for ensuring informed consent in legal agreements.
